成功在家擦肩

  • 任青牛伯伯
    怎么做到的
  • t
    theyoung
    这个?
    【技术向】教你把自家路由器变成老任擦肩中继站!
    http://tieba.baidu.com/p/2524680710
  • l
    luoyianwu
    神了 还真的是看ssid啊
    这样擦一次能擦满十个吗?
  • 琴酒
    從昨天到今天查了20來人
    不過 改一次MAC地址後如果擦到人呢,要8小時後才能同一個地址擦到第二個人
    所以 要多擦肩就要不停改MAC地址
    目前在測試路由器的 10分鐘 自動換MAC腳本
  • 琴酒
    我自己是買了個TPLINKWR703N 刷了DD-WRT的
    然後接在自己主路由DLINK-624+A下做二級路由
    然後703N MAC白名單只能3DS連,然後SSID 改成attwifi 不加密
    只是目前自動換MAC腳本有問題,GBATEMP的網友在幫我debug
  • n
    nw77
    嗯,不错,回家搞。
  • 任青牛伯伯
    什么时候能搞日本站了再来学一下,欧美对我毫无意义
  • d
    dpheix1
    终于不用带2个LL出来擦肩了。
  • 8
    851125
    你以为欧美热点只有欧美版用户么
  • 琴酒
    日本熱點搞不定
    這在很早以前搞 nintendo zone時候就是過 日本 光改SSID一樣 也沒用
  • 纯战士
    这要是真的真实太棒了啊!!!!!!!!!!!
  • 小石子
    只有濱口一个擦肩的玩家高兴的哭了
  • 8
    851125
    要改wlan的mac,通常原厂的OS不支持,要刷机
  • 琴酒
  • 出山紅沙
    我啥不干在家还真擦到过2次人...不知道哪个基友从我家后面那马路走过....
  • s
    shanajiang
    这个貌似得刷路由器吧...?好像很麻烦...
  • 琴酒
    看我5樓那個鏈接 有幾種解決方法
  • 小石子
    白高兴了,原来XP不行
  • q
    quki1945
    舍友上周擦到个妹子

    留言是任青尼好,任天堂万岁
  • 纯战士
    必须win7??
  • s
    shanajiang
    ...又用手机试了下…失败了…
  • k
    keytomylife
    MARK回家研究
  • 琴酒
    順便 すれちがい通信中継所 是最新固件加的功能
    如果你不是 就不要測試了
  • 樱桐
    话说你的10分钟换MAC的脚本成功了么,我同样是703N,完全无效。。。
  • 琴酒
    成功了
    http://gbatemp.net/threads/how-t ... age-10#post-4739510
    仔細看 FAQ
    首先 WEBUI 狀態那是看不出MAC改變的
    要TELNET 進去後 用命令看
    ifconfig $(nvram get wl0_ifname)
    我目前 Cron 是 */15 * * * * root /tmp/nzone 也就是15分鐘換一次
    克隆无线MAC 設置的是那個主要的4E:53:50:4F:4F:46
    啟動腳本用的上面鏈接裡的182樓

    以為下個人心得
    家裡本來就有一個路由器,dlink624+a,由於不能刷DD-WRT,所以在淘寶買了個MINI路由器,TPLINK WR703N
    新路由器拿到手後,首先是去下面網站下載固件
    http://www.dd-wrt.com/site/support/router-database
    輸入你買的路由器的型號,如果能刷DDWRT就會顯示出來,然後記得注意硬件版本,刷的固件和硬件版本不一樣,會損壞路由器
    703就1個,直接點擊就好了,然後直接下載v24 preSP2 (Build 21061)這個版本,因為自動換MAC腳本是基於這個的。
    從原廠固件刷成DDWRT的話請下載factory-to-ddwrt.bin。
    wr703n上電,默認是AP模式,用自己電腦的網線連上後,打192.168.1.1進入TPLINK設置頁面,然後去升級固件那刷剛才下載的DDWRT固件,刷完等他重啟。
    重啟完後,打192.168.1.1進入DDWRT設置頁面,第一次會讓你設置進路由器的用戶名和密碼。
    由於我是把wr703n接在dlink624+a下面的,而dlink624+a默認地址是192.168.0.1,所以我要修改wr703n的路由地址,setup-basic setup-network setup-router ip,我自己是設置成192.168.0.254,subnet mask 255.255.255.0,gatway192.168.0.1,dns 8.8.8.8,下面的DHCP disable,mac address clone enable,下面的clone wireless mac 改成4E:53:50:4F:4F:46,wireless-ssid 改成attwifi,不要加密,然後mac filter 設置白名單只能3DS能連上。
    腳本輸入參考
    http://gbatemp.net/threads/how-t ... age-10#post-4739510
    最後應用
    然後就能從dlink624+a的lan口連線到wr703n了

    System Information只能看到我上面設置的MAC地址 就是4E:53:50:4F:4F:46,要確認腳本是否成功,開始運行telnet 192.168.0.254,然後用戶名是root,密碼是你最開始設置的密碼,然後等一段時間,看你設置的間隔是多久,然後在telnet輸入ifconfig $(nvram get wl0_ifname),來看MAC時候改變
  • 樱桐
    我的错,没仔细看变量赋值,我是用的client+虚拟网卡ap模式,修改mac地址修改错了
  • p
    purdre
    5楼的帖子跟着做了一下,WINDOW的做到改完 MAC ADDRESS就搞定了?
    NINTENDO ZONE 的图标一直闪,但是点进去就是连接不上是啥毛病……
  • p
    purdre
    然后设置好了还一直 ERROR CODE 013-9202 COULD NOT CONNECT TO NINTENDO ZONE,一开始连接NINTENDO ZONE就没信号啊明明平时都是满格:'(
  • 琴酒
    你無線是不是加密了 加密了就連不上NZ
  • p
    purdre
    virtual router 要开始无线不是必须要密码来着吗?
  • n
    nw77
    是连不上的,但是已经可以擦肩了。原文有说,因为虚拟AP设了密码,所以连不上。
    (*you can't use nintendo zone app because your are using an AP with encryption)

    我这边已经擦肩成功了,正在测试那个自动cycle 100次MAC地址的后台程序。
    感觉win7 + 虚拟AP更方便。省得搞DDWRT了。
  • 萨兰丁
    5楼的教程一直卡在 "Wireless Network Connection". Please take in mind that this should be your Wireless Network adapter name, and NOT the one of your just-created "virtual network", nor the name of your wired adapter.这里?
    这个无线连接输入的到底是什么名字啊orz
  • d
    downnote
    后半段就看不懂了……
    我已经刷完了机,然后接下来要怎么做,比如脚本是怎么设置的,在哪里
  • 琴酒
    你是直接做主路由 還是接在主路由下面
    筆記本的話是win7+虛擬AP 方便
    在家只有台式機的話 還是個路由好點
  • p
    purdre
    控制面板→ 网络共享中心→ 左上角的适应器设置,然后看你的无线连接是什么名字
  • 萨兰丁
    唔原来就是简单粗暴的wi-fi这两个字。。。。
    于是现在设置好了virtual router adapter,3DS连上attwifi后测试链接显示能连上路由但是连不上internet- -太诡异ORZ显示的是error003-2002的样子呢
    这样的话看它提示是要修改DNS还是啥。。。。
    然后莫名其妙的。。。擦到一个了……?!
  • p
    purdre
    原来如此,感谢回答,我在想不用VIRTUAL ROUTER行不行得通
  • 8
    851125
    大大,我在巴哈看到这样一串代码
    1. echo -e "#!/bin/sh\nLIST=/tmp/mac.list\nROW=\$(head -n 1 \$LIST)\nTOTAL=\$(grep : -c \$LIST)\nif [ \$ROW -gt \$TOTAL ]; then\nMAC="00:0D:67:15:2D:82"\nelse\nMAC=\$(sed -n \$((\$ROW

    2. +1))p \$LIST)\nfi\nWLINT=\$(nvram get wl0_ifname)\nAPDCNF=/tmp/\${WLINT}_hostap.conf\nAPDPID=/var/run/\${WLINT}_hostapd.pid\nif [ -e \$APDCNF ]; then\nkill \$(cat \$APDPID)\nsed -ri

    3. s/bssid=.*/bssid=\$MAC/ \$APDCNF\nhostapd -B -P \$APDPID \$APDCNF\nelse\nifconfig \$WLINT down\nifconfig \$WLINT hw ether \$MAC\nifconfig \$WLINT up\nif [ \$ROW -ge \$TOTAL ];

    4. then\nNEXT=1\nelse\nNEXT=\$((\$ROW+1))\nfi\nsed -i 1s/.*/\$NEXT/ \$LIST\nfi" >/tmp/autoMAC; chmod 555 /tmp/autoMAC;echo -e

    5. "1\n4E:53:50:4F:4F:40\n4E:53:50:4F:4F:41\n4E:53:50:4F:4F:42\n4E:53:50:4F:4F:43\n4E:53:50:4F:4F:44\n4E:53:50:4F:4F:45\n4E:53:50:4F:4F:46\n4E:53:50:4F:4F:47\n4E:53:50:4F:4F:48\n4E:53:50:4F:4F:49

    6. \n4E:53:50:4F:4F:4A\n4E:53:50:4F:4F:4B\n4E:53:50:4F:4F:4C\n4E:53:50:4F:4F:4D\n4E:53:50:4F:4F:4E\n4E:53:50:4F:4F:4F" > /tmp/mac.list
    复制代码
    我想问下,我自己要加mac的话要怎么改?
    我比较小白,不会看代码
  • 琴酒
    巴哈這人的路由器的DD-WRT不能用GBATEMP的腳本
    於是他自己寫了 一堆MAC list 然後抽取
    你要加MAC的話 直接把最後的4E:53:50:4F:4F:4F"
    改成這樣4E:53:50:4F:4F:4F\n我是MAC1\n我是MAC2"難道你路由器也是那 Buffalo WGR什麼的?
  • 琴酒
    你應該是TGFC那個吧 買的 WGR614
  • d
    downnote
    我直接做主路由,因为只有一个。还有虽然是Win7但是不想再卖无线卡了
    其实我就是不知道代码加在哪儿
  • 8
    851125
    对...对代码什么的比较白痴,所以直接入的刷好的............................
  • 琴酒
    主路由的話 那IP就是192.168.1.1 DHCP開啟
    你現在能上網的話 那說明 撥號什麼的都設置好了吧
    然後 UI改成中文的話
    設置 MAC地址克隆 啟動 克隆無線MAC 輸入 4e 53 50 4f 4f 46 應用
    無線 無線模式AP SSID attwifi 無線安全 安全模式 禁用
    然後MAC過濾 啟用過濾 之永續所列客戶端訪問無線 編輯MAC過濾列表,因為你是主路由 不光3DS 其他無線設備也設置下 應用
    管理 管理 Cron 啟用 下面Cron 附加任务方框輸入 */15 * * * * root /tmp/nzone 應用
    管理 命令 輸入
    1. echo -e "#!/bin/sh\nTITLES="OO@OOAOOBOOCOODOOEOOFOOGOOHOOIOOJOOKOOLOOMOONOOO"\nBASE="NSP"\nRANDOM=\$(head -c 2 /dev/urandom | hexdump -e '1/2 "%u"')\nCTR=\$((\$RANDOM%\$((\$(expr length \$TITLES)/3))))\nMAC=\$(echo -e \$BASE\$TITLES | cut -c 1-3,\$((\$CTR*3+4))-\$((\$CTR*3+6)) | hexdump -e '6/1 "%02X:"' | head -c 17)\nWLINT=\$(nvram get wl0_ifname)\nAPDCNF=/tmp/\${WLINT}_hostap.conf\nAPDPID=/var/run/\${WLINT}_hostapd.pid\nif [ -e \$APDCNF ]; then\nkill \$(cat \$APDPID)\nsleep 3\nsed -ri s/bssid=.*/bssid=\$MAC/ \$APDCNF\nhostapd -B -P \$APDPID \$APDCNF\nelse\nifconfig \$WLINT down\nifconfig \$WLINT hw ether \$MAC\nifconfig \$WLINT up\nfi \necho \$MAC >> /tmp/macschanged.txt" >/tmp/nzone; chmod 555 /tmp/nzone
    复制代码
    運行命令 添加啟動指令
    然後 開始 運行 CMD
    telnet 192.168.1.1 輸入用戶名 root 輸入密碼不顯示的 就是你WEB登錄192.168.1.1的密碼
    然後輸入 ifconfig $(nvram get wl0_ifname)
    應該會看到現在 MAC 是4e:53:50:4f:4f:46
    然後不要關閉 等15分鐘後 繼續 ifconfig $(nvram get wl0_ifname)
    看看MAC地址是不是變了
    或者cat /tmp/macschanged.txt
    看他到底變了幾次 然後每次是哪個MAC

    如果不變 最好去GBATEMP註冊 然後PM那個人 幫你debug
    我就是昨天下午 和今天下午 和他聊天後才搞定的
    因為昨天的第一版代碼 我不會變MAC
  • d
    downnote
    感谢感谢
  • 琴酒
    如果美版機器的話 而且玩動物森林 就能去nz下各種配信道具了
    日版機器遊戲不能下美版NZ裡的悲劇 淚木
    目前沒任何辦法能連上日本的nz
  • d
    downnote
    现在NZ可以上
    但是CMD里面的下面两条命令显示"不是内部命令或外部命令……或批处理文件"
    ifconfig $(nvram get wl0_ifname)
    cat /tmp/macschanged.txt

    这两个命令行是那条复制代码设置进model里的吗?
  • l
    luoyianwu
    安卓端安定